WARNING This entry warns of a risk of serious personal injury or even death. CAUTION This entry warns of a risk of personal injury or physical damage. Important safety instruction follow them always when handling the product. giving off smoke, smelling strange, took a liquid or an object inside, broken, etc. ) If an abnormality should occur, unplug the projector urgently. Unplug the projector from the power outlet if the projector is not used for the time being. Do not open or remove any portion of the product, unless the manuals direct Modify neither the projector nor accessories. Let neither any things nor any liquids enter to the inside of the product. - Do not place the product on an unstable place such as the uneven surface or the leaned table. Place the projector so that it (even the lens part installed) does not protrude from the surface where the projector is placed on. - Remove all the attachments including the power cord and cables, from the projector when carrying the projector. Do not look into the lens and the openings on the projector, while the lamp is on. Do not approach the lamp cover and the exhaust vents, while the projection lamp is on.
